Most not too long ago, it's been identified that conolidine and the above derivatives act on the atypical chemokine receptor 3 (ACKR3. Expressed in equivalent places as classical opioid receptors, it binds to the wide array of endogenous opioids. Contrary to most opioid receptors, this receptor acts as a scavenger and isn't going to activate a 2nd messenger process (59). As talked over by Meyrath et al., this also indicated a achievable website link in between these receptors as well as endogenous opiate method (59). This analyze eventually identified which the ACKR3 receptor didn't deliver any G protein sign reaction by measuring and discovering no mini G protein interactions, not like classical opiate receptors, which recruit these proteins for signaling.

Plants are actually Traditionally a source Conolidine Proleviate for myofascial pain syndrome of analgesic alkaloids, Even though their pharmacological characterization is usually constrained. Among the these all-natural analgesic molecules, conolidine, located in the bark of your tropical flowering shrub Tabernaemontana divaricata, also known as pinwheel flower or crepe jasmine, has extended been Utilized in regular Chinese, Ayurvedic and Thai medicines to take care of fever and pain4 (Fig. 1a). Pharmacologists have only a short while ago been able to verify its medicinal and pharmacological properties owing to its very first asymmetric total synthesis.5 Conolidine is often a unusual C5-nor stemmadenine (Fig. 1b), which displays strong analgesia in in vivo models of tonic and persistent pain and minimizes inflammatory pain reduction. It absolutely was also prompt that conolidine-induced analgesia might lack issues commonly linked to classical opioid drugs.

Investigation on conolidine is proscribed, even so the handful of studies available exhibit the drug retains promise to be a attainable opiate-like therapeutic for Persistent pain. Conolidine was to start with synthesized in 2011 as Component of a analyze by Tarselli et al. (60) The initial de novo pathway to artificial generation identified that their synthesized variety served as effective analgesics in opposition to Persistent, persistent pain within an in-vivo model (60). A biphasic pain design was used, by which formalin Remedy is injected into a rodent’s paw. This ends in a Main pain reaction right away subsequent injection plus a secondary pain reaction twenty - 40 minutes following injection (62).
